I am filling up the ds-156 forms for my children both are below 12 years old, do I have to sign item 41?

Item 41 on the DS 156 form is where the applicant's signature will be placed. He/she certifies that he/she have read and understood all the questions set forth in the application. But the forms were prepared by me on their behalf. I think I will be the one who will signed it, I am right?

Answer:
You are right. But you don't sign line 41; you check box YES on line 39, then complete and sign the applications on line 40 (not 41) for your children.
